A 33-year-old male asked:
Is rice cake is good to loose weights?

Rice Cakes: If eaten plain, rice cakes transiently fill you up with very few calories consumed.
It is a carb and may trigger hunger once eaten and an unwanted insulin surge so that anything you eat on will be quickly stored as fat.

Probably not: Rice cakes, though somewhat low in calories (35-50), have quite a high glycemic index. This means that it can bring your blood sugar up more than other foods. This is not good for weight loss.

More protein: Rice is a carbohydrate and stimulates insulin production. In the presence of excess carbohydrate, the body stores the excess carbohydrate calories as fat. Try to eat 1 gram of protein for every 3 grams of carbohydrate each time that you eat.
